Animated director Yan Shanghao, who participated in the 2011 Hong Kong Asian Film Festival, presents his critically acclaimed work, following his previous film which humorously took jabs at "pigs" and used extreme intelligence to reflect the harsh realities of life. This latest piece is the only Asian animation nominated at the Toronto International Film Festival, satirizing the hypocrisy of the church. Is a person always clearly good or evil? Are church leaders necessarily good people? In a small town in South Korea, there is a prophecy predicting an impending flood. A respected church elder vows to bring faith and hope to the congregation. As long as they are willing to donate money, he promises to help them rebuild their homes. However, his funding plan is questioned by a notoriously bad-mouthed townsman. The two engage in a battle of "image," each with their own motives.
